diff --git a/lnbits/extensions/watchonly/static/components/address-list/address-list.js b/lnbits/extensions/watchonly/static/components/address-list/address-list.js index 6a77422c..7d6664c8 100644 --- a/lnbits/extensions/watchonly/static/components/address-list/address-list.js +++ b/lnbits/extensions/watchonly/static/components/address-list/address-list.js @@ -4,7 +4,7 @@ async function addressList(path) { name: 'address-list', template, - props: ['accounts', 'mempool_endpoint', 'inkey'], + props: ['accounts', 'mempool_endpoint', 'inkey', 'sats_denominated'], watch: { immediate: true, accounts(newVal, oldVal) { diff --git a/lnbits/extensions/watchonly/static/components/payment/payment.html b/lnbits/extensions/watchonly/static/components/payment/payment.html new file mode 100644 index 00000000..e69de29b diff --git a/lnbits/extensions/watchonly/static/components/payment/payment.js b/lnbits/extensions/watchonly/static/components/payment/payment.js new file mode 100644 index 00000000..809f57a3 --- /dev/null +++ b/lnbits/extensions/watchonly/static/components/payment/payment.js @@ -0,0 +1,21 @@ +async function payment(path) { + const template = await loadTemplateAsync(path) + Vue.component('payment', { + name: 'payment', + template, + + props: ['mempool_endpoint', 'sats_denominated'], + + data: function () { + return {} + }, + + methods: { + satBtc(val, showUnit = true) { + return satOrBtc(val, showUnit, this['sats_denominated']) + } + }, + + created: async function () {} + }) +} diff --git a/lnbits/extensions/watchonly/static/components/utxo-list/utxo-list.html b/lnbits/extensions/watchonly/static/components/utxo-list/utxo-list.html index 97b889e3..d5a9e353 100644 --- a/lnbits/extensions/watchonly/static/components/utxo-list/utxo-list.html +++ b/lnbits/extensions/watchonly/static/components/utxo-list/utxo-list.html @@ -1,18 +1,18 @@
- - -
+
+
+
@@ -60,7 +60,7 @@ /> - +
@@ -133,10 +133,9 @@